In Mauricio PochettinoIn the perfect universe, everyone in the U.S. player pool will maintain top health and fitness throughout the World Cup roster selection process and well into this summer’s soccer fun.

Reality, however, has other ideas.

And for six weeks until he announces his 26 selections, Pochettino will see players return from and succumb to injuries.

This weekend there was movement in both directions, much of it positive.

Midfielder tyler adams He appeared in a Premier League match for the first time since injuring his quadriceps on March 3. Coming on in the 70th minute, he played a major role in the high press that forced a breakaway and sparked Bournemouth’s tie-breaking goal for a 2-1 stunner at leaders Arsenal. The Cherries are unbeaten in 12 games.

The 2022 World Cup captain is almost certainly an American starter when available, something he hasn’t been since September due to injuries and the birth of a child. He has six games left to regain his rhythm… and avoid another setback.

Sidelined since injuring his leg in the United States camp two weeks ago, the midfielder Johnny Cardoso He has resumed training with Atlético Madrid and could be ready for the second leg of the Champions League quarterfinals on Tuesday against Barcelona or the Copa del Rey final on Saturday against Real Sociedad.

Back Sergiño DestAn American starter when healthy, he is on track to return to PSV Eindhoven this season after injuring a hamstring on March 8. The Dutch Eredivisie champions have four games left.

“From what I’ve heard from him personally and from the medical staff, everything is going very well and he will probably get some minutes this season,” coach Peter Bosz said. “So I’m very happy about that.”

In the fight for third place in American goalkeeping, the Cincinnati team Roman Celentan He returned from an injury that forced him to withdraw from the national team camp.

With the good comes the bad. Less than a week after the preview Patricio Agyemang He was ruled out of the World Cup squad due to an Achilles tendon injury, left back. John Tolkin He suffered a possible ACL injury on Friday with second-division side Holstein Kiel.

Behind Antonio Robinson and Max Arfsten In the U.S. pecking order, Tolkin was not invited to the recent camp and was a long shot for the World Cup team.

However, his absence undermines Pochettino’s group, as do the Celtic centre-back’s long-term injuries. Cameron Carter-Vickers (Achilles tendon) and defensive midfielder for St. Pauli James Arenas (ankle).

Miles RobinsonA regular in a short corps of center backs, he hasn’t played for Cincinnati since a groin strain in U.S. camp last month kept him out of both friendlies.

France

Striker Folarin Balogun remains in fabulous form, scoring in the 36th minute of Monaco’s 4-1 loss to Paris FC – his sixth consecutive game with a goal and eighth in the last nine games to take his Ligue 1 tally to 11 and his total to 17 in 38 games.

It was a much worse weekend for the center Mark McKenziewhose 48th-minute red card for bringing down a free-running opponent helped turn a one-goal deficit into Toulouse’s 4-0 lead against Lille.

Tim Weah Starting at right-back, he went all the way in a 3-1 victory over bottom-place Metz, leaving Olympique Marseille one point away from the third and final automatic Champions League spot next season.

Midfielder Tanner Tessmann He came on in the 82nd minute of fifth-placed Lyon’s 2-0 victory over Lorient.

Italy

Despite creating opportunities for himself and his teammates (and earning AC Milan’s best analytical score), Christian Pulisic He remained scoreless in 16 appearances for club and country in 2026, going 72 minutes without a goal in a 3-0 loss to Udinese.

Midfielder-defender-forward Weston McKennie He served a yellow card suspension during Juventus’ 1-0 win at Atalanta, which left the midfielder yunus musah on the bench for the third time in four games.

England

Three days after the center Chris Richards and Crystal Palace began the UEFA Conference League quarterfinals with a convincing victory over Fiorentina, the Eagles scoring twice late to defeat Newcastle, 2-1, for their third straight win and improve to 6-1-3 in 10 matches in all competitions.

Antonee Robinson played 69 minutes in Fulham’s 2-0 defeat to Liverpool, his fourth consecutive Premier League start.

Only three points from the relegation zone, midfielder Brendan Aaronson and Leeds visits Manchester United on Monday.

In the Second Division Championship, ahead Haji Wright They went goalless for the fourth game in a row and first-place Coventry City settled for a 0-0 home draw with last-place Sheffield Wednesday. However, Wright is enjoying a good season with 16 league goals (17 in total) and Coventry are on course for promotion to the Premier League after a 25-year wait.

In the 1-0 defeat against Portsmouth, the central midfielder Aidan Morris He played 90 minutes for Middlesbrough, who have not won in six games and, after flirting with first place, are now looking to the promotion playoff.

Germany

While returning Joe Scally He played 90 minutes for Mönchengladbach in a 1-0 loss to RB Leipzig. gio reyna I didn’t play. Of the nine Bundesliga games in which he has been in uniform in 2026, the midfielder played three games for a total of 34 minutes.

Midfielder Malik Tillman He came on in the 90th minute of Bayer Leverkusen’s 1-0 victory over Borussia Dortmund, leaving him with five minutes played in two games since returning from duty in the United States.

Noahkai BanksThe dual-national centre-back, weighing the chances of the United States and Germany, remained on the bench for the third time in four games in Augsburg’s draw with Hoffenheim, 2-2.

Spain

Back Alex Freeman continues to struggle for playing time at third-place Villarreal and sat out the 2-1 win over Athletic Bilbao. The former Orlando City standout has played 58 minutes in five games since arriving in late January.

Netherlands

In his twelfth league start, the PSV Eindhoven striker ricardo pepi He scored his 11th Eredivisie goal, in first-half stoppage time, as part of an 83-minute effort during the Eredivisie champions’ 2–0 victory at Sparta Rotterdam. The Texan has also scored three goals in the Champions League.
